Among fatal plane crashes that occurred during the past 50 years, 481 were due to pilot error, 99 were due to other human error, 569 were due to weather, 386 were due to mechanical problems, and 256 were due to sabotage. D Construct the relative frequency distribution. What is the most serious threat to aviation safety, and can anything be done about it? Complete the relative frequency distribution below. Relative Cause Frequency Pilot error Other human error % Weather % Mechanical problems Sabotage (Round to one decimal place as needed.) What is the most serious threat to aviation safety, and can anything be done about it? O A. Mechanical problems are the most serious threat to aviation safety. New planes could be better engineered. O B. Weather is the most serious threat to aviation safety. Weather monitoring systems could be improved. O C. Sabotage is the most serious threat to aviation safety. Airport security could be increased O D. Pilot error is the most serious threat to aviation safety. Pilots could be better trained.
